PROGRAM OBJECTIVE

FDMC programs are designed to create innovative solutions to reduce the disproportionate amount of unfilled orders issued by the Defense Logistics Agency as caused by shortcomings in forging supply chains. Via a portfolio of projects, the program is investigating, developing and deploying concepts to improve the quality, productivity and technology of the US forging industry. Ultimately, the FDMC teams are striving to implement this suite of solutions across industry and government to support the warfighter requiring forged components. Current FDMC programs include Innovative Forging Technologies (IFT) and Emergent Research and Development.
